I am trying to get Bertrand Meyers book "Object Oriented Software Construction" using inter-library loans. For this purpose I need the name of a publication where this book has been referenced. Could somebody please send me a reference for such a publication. In the absence of such a reference the ISBN of the book would also be of help. Thanks. Diptendu Dutta

In article <1776@dvinci.USask.CA> dutta@skorpio.Usask.ca (Diptendu Dutta) writes: >I am trying to get Bertrand Meyers book "Object Oriented Software >Construction" using inter-library loans. For this purpose I need the >name of a publication where this book has been referenced. Could >somebody please send me a reference for such a publication. The book you want is: Meyer, B. "Object Oriented Software Construction", Prentice-Hall International series in Computer Science, C.A.R. Hoare, Series Editor. Prentice Hall, New York, Copy. 1988. The book costs $40.00, and is available from either the publisher or from Meyer's company, Interactive Software Engineering, Inc., which also sells his language, Eiffel. There is a newsgroup for the language, comp.lang.eiffel, and Dr. Meyer reads it regularly if you need more help. -- Dave Hampton -- Reply to: uiucuxc!tikal!phred!daveh {Dave Hampton} Addr: Research Division, Physio-Control Corp.
